Searched refs:AT91_PMC_PCKR (Results 1 – 4 of 4) sorted by relevance
/Linux-v4.19/drivers/clk/at91/ |
D | clk-programmable.c | 49 regmap_read(prog->regmap, AT91_PMC_PCKR(prog->id), &pckr); in clk_programmable_recalc_rate() 114 regmap_update_bits(prog->regmap, AT91_PMC_PCKR(prog->id), mask, pckr); in clk_programmable_set_parent() 126 regmap_read(prog->regmap, AT91_PMC_PCKR(prog->id), &pckr); in clk_programmable_get_parent() 145 regmap_read(prog->regmap, AT91_PMC_PCKR(prog->id), &pckr); in clk_programmable_set_rate() 158 regmap_update_bits(prog->regmap, AT91_PMC_PCKR(prog->id), in clk_programmable_set_rate()
|
D | pmc.c | 134 regmap_read(pmcreg, AT91_PMC_PCKR(num), &pmc_cache.pckr[num]); in pmc_suspend() 179 regmap_write(pmcreg, AT91_PMC_PCKR(num), pmc_cache.pckr[num]); in pmc_resume()
|
/Linux-v4.19/include/linux/clk/ |
D | at91_pmc.h | 134 #define AT91_PMC_PCKR(n) (0x40 + ((n) * 4)) /* Programmable Clock 0-N Registers */ macro
|
/Linux-v4.19/arch/arm/mach-at91/ |
D | pm.c | 211 css = readl(pm_data.pmc + AT91_PMC_PCKR(i)) & AT91_PMC_CSS; in at91_pm_verify_clocks()
|